Karavada/ Rice and lentil fritters

Delicious Karavada/ Rice and Lentil fritters made with rice, chana dal and leftover dosa batter.

Ingredients

  • 1 ¼ Cup /250g Parboiled Rice If you have Doppi rice in hand use it
  • ¼ Cup/47g chana dal/split chickpeas soaked for 40 minutes
  • ½ cup one day old dosa batter
  • 1 Green chili
  • 1 tablespoon chopped ginger
  • ½ teaspoon red chili powder
  • ¾ te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on rice powder
  • 1 ¾ cup water
  • teaspoon of Asafoetida
  • teaspoon of Baking soda optional, I didn’t used it
  • 2 sprig Curry leaves chopped
  • 4 Cups Canola Oil

Instructions

  • Soak rice and chana dal for 40 minutes. Wash and drain the rice and chana dal in a colander and set aside.
  • Grind soaked rice in a grinder using 1 ¾ cup of water add water as needed. Make sure to grind into a coarse paste .
  • In a medium bowl, to the ground batter mix in, ginger, green chili, salt , red chilli, dosa batter and asafoetida, soaked chana dal and curry leaves. set aside.If the batter is not thick add rice powder and make it into thick batter so that you can make balls out of it.
  • In a thick bottom pan heat oil to 350 F, add a drop of batter to check oil is ready, if it is ready, dough will comes up immediately. Then add medium sized balls and fry for about 6-7 minutes or until they become golden brown color, flipping in between.
  • Using a slotted spoon, remove the fried fritters from oil and transfer to kitchen towel to remove
  • excess oil.
  • Enjoy warm with coconut chutney and Sambhar.

Notes

Use doppi rice for making it traditional.
